What Are Transmission Problems?

Definition and Position of the Transmission

Your vehicle's transmission is a crucial component, acting because the bridge between your engine's energy and the wheels. It manages the engine's rotational speed, permitting you to smoothly speed up, decelerate, and navigate completely different terrains. With Out a properly functioning transmission, your car merely wouldn't transfer effectively, or in any respect. Think of it like a gearbox in a bicycle; it permits you to change gears to go properly with totally different speeds and gradients. In vehicles, this could be a far more advanced system, handling far higher power and requiring exact synchronization.

Common Causes of Transmission Problems

Low or Contaminated Transmission Fluid

Transmission fluid serves because the lifeblood of your automatic transmission, lubricating and cooling inner parts. Low fluid levels, due to leaks or improper maintenance, could cause friction, overheating, and untimely put on. Contaminated fluid, containing particles or particles, can equally harm delicate internal elements. Often checking your transmission fluid level and situation is crucial preventive maintenance, easily accomplished with the help of your owner's handbook and a simple dipstick check. Wear and Tear of Transmission Components

Over time, like any mechanical system, transmissions experience put on and tear. This is particularly true for older autos or those subjected to heavy use or harsh driving conditions. Elements like clutches, bands, and gears can put on down, resulting in decreased efficiency and eventual failure. Common maintenance and careful driving might help extend the life of your transmission, but ultimately, some components will need replacement. This is a natural process that can not be entirely avoided, though correct maintenance can certainly prolong its lifespan.

Faulty Transmission Solenoids or Sensors

Modern transmissions rely closely on digital controls, together with solenoids and sensors. These elements regulate fluid flow and shift timing. Malfunctions in these electronic parts can lead to irregular shifting, harsh engagement, or complete transmission failure. A diagnostic scan can typically pinpoint these problems, a service available at most auto repair outlets in areas like Richmond, Delta, and New Westminster.

Mechanical Failures and Inside Damage

Sometimes, inner parts throughout the transmission may fail because of manufacturing defects, extreme wear, or damage from low fluid ranges or contamination. This can range from broken gears to damaged planetary sets, requiring extensive repairs or a whole transmission substitute. Recognizing the indicators early, similar to uncommon grinding or knocking noises, is essential for minimizing the extent of harm.

External Components like Overheating or Poor Maintenance

Overheating is a major enemy of automated transmissions. Prolonged operation underneath heavy masses, towing, you could try these out or driving in extreme warmth can result in vital damage. Neglecting routine maintenance, corresponding to rare fluid modifications, can also contribute to premature failure. Recognizing the Indicators of Transmission Problems

Slipping Gears and Erratic Shifting

A frequent symptom is the feeling that your transmission is slipping or not engaging correctly. Gears could not have interaction smoothly, or the car would possibly rev unexpectedly without corresponding acceleration. This can be a subtle signal at first however will worsen over time if left unaddressed.

Delayed Engagement or Issue Starting

If your car hesitates before engaging into gear, or if there's difficulty getting the car to move from a standstill, your transmission could be struggling. This delay could be extra pronounced in cold climate, but if it's a consistent drawback, skilled assistance is advisable.

Unusual Noises (Grinding, Whining)

Grinding, whining, or humming noises coming from the transmission space indicate potential points. These noises often signify metal-on-metal contact or broken components inside the transmission. They are often a transparent indication that an issue needs immediate consideration.

Fluid Leaks or Burning Smell

Leaking transmission fluid is a major problem. It can lead to low fluid levels and harm to inside elements. A distinctive burning smell, often accompanied by smoke, suggests overheating and certain fluid degradation. These indicate a important scenario needing pressing attention.

Dashboard Warning Lights

Modern autos often have transmission warning lights on the dashboard. These ought to never be ignored. If a warning gentle illuminates, it’s a critical signal that something is mistaken and needs instant attention to prevent additional injury.

Diagnosing Transmission Issues

Visual Inspection and Fluid Checks

A visual inspection can generally reveal external leaks or injury. Checking the transmission fluid degree and condition (color, odor, clarity) is a straightforward yet essential first step. Low fluid, burnt fluid or uncommon debris indicate inside problems.

Use of Diagnostic Instruments (OBD-II Scanners)

OBD-II scanners can learn diagnostic bother codes (DTCs) saved throughout the vehicle's computer system. These codes can present priceless insights into the precise nature of the transmission issue. Many auto components stores supply OBD-II scanner rentals.

Preventive Measures and Maintenance Tips

Regular Transmission Fluid Changes

Following the producer's recommended schedule for transmission fluid and filter modifications is crucial for preventing untimely wear and tear. Utilizing the proper type and amount of fluid can additionally be important.

Monitoring for Early Symptoms

Pay close consideration to how your vehicle shifts and listen for any unusual noises. Early detection of problems can prevent cash and prevent main repairs down the street.

Proper Driving Habits to Cut Back Stress

Avoid aggressive driving habits, such as speedy acceleration and harsh braking. These actions put undue stress on the transmission. Smooth driving habits will delay transmission health.

When to Repair or Replace the Transmission

Assessing the Severity of the Problem

The severity of the issue will determine whether or not repair or replacement is necessary. Minor points may solely require fluid changes or solenoid replacements. Main internal injury typically necessitates an entire rebuild or substitute.

Cost-Benefit Analysis of Repairs vs. Replacement

Weigh the price of repairs against the price of a alternative transmission. Sometimes, a rebuild or replacement may be less expensive than extensive repairs, particularly for older vehicles.
